The Natural Way to Eat the Rainbow

[caption id="attachment_9203" align="alignright" width="403" caption="Color Vibe 5K 2012"][/caption]

When this time of year rolls around it is always a great idea to remind yourself to eat the rainbow by pursing colorful fruits and vegetables. Lean away from the beige food groups and replacing them with bright colors.

A good starting point would be adding vegetables to some of your at-home favorites. Try H3’s Macaroni and Cheese with Broccoli recipe. This recipe hits home with a healthy combo of comfort and colors.

Add color to each meal and by the end of the day you will have a rainbow of colors in your body. Adding colorful fruits and vegetables to your nutrition plan means adding nutrients to your body. The more fruits and vegetables you eat means you’re also consuming more nutrients, thus developing a healthier immune system. Hopefully, leading to no cold or flu this season.
